Olive wood boasts a remarkable texture that distinguishes it as a natural masterpiece. From its roots to its branches, each part of the olive tree carries a unique story reflected in its intricate patterns. This distinct texture is highly prized in furniture and decor, where it adds both aesthetic appeal and durability to pieces. Olive wood's natural oils contribute to its resistance against decay, making it a sustainable and long-lasting choice. In essence, olive wood's unique texture brings the elegance and beauty of nature into our homes, serving as a testament to the wonders of the natural world.

The olive tree is known not only for its healthy and delicious fruits but also for its durable and aesthetically pleasing wood. For thousands of years, people have used olive wood for furniture, decoration, and crafts. The aesthetic value and durability of olive wood make it a unique and sought-after option.
